It is shown that the specific space distribution of the nucleon axial charge may lead to the significant reduction of the cross section of the reaction p + p → D + e + ν and may provide the mechanism to explain observed deficit of solar neutrinos. We analyze nuclear effects in the deep inelastic scattering on deuteron in the framework of the covariant approach. It is shown that this approach gives us the way to investigate the role of relativistic effects in the deep inelastic scattering (DIS) on deuteron, such as the relativistic kinematics and the off-mass-shell behavior of the Compton amplitude of nucleon in the consistent manner. A superconducting solenoid for WASA. General project description and status (February 91) Abstract A thin walled superconducting warm bore solenoid with a central magnetic eld of 1.5 Tesla is being designed for the WASA 4 detector for particle physics experiments at the CELSIUS ring. Collisions between hadronic systems at relativistic energies provide a window on the small-x gluon distributions of fast moving nuclei. It has been predicted that gluon saturation effects will manifest themselves as a suppression in the transverse momentum (p t) distribution at a scale which is connected with the rapidity of the measured particles. We analyse the proton and deutron data on spin dependent asymmetry A 1 (x, Q 2) supposing the DIS structure functions g 1 (x, Q 2) and F 3 (x, Q 2) have the similar Q 2-dependence. As a result, we have obtained Γ p 1 − Γ n 1 = 0.192 at Q 2 = 10 GeV 2 and Γ p 1 − Γ n 1 = 0.165 at Q 2 = 3 GeV 2 , in the best agreement with the Bjorken sum rule predictions.
